Common Font Rendering Issues in Grocery List Apps: Causes and Fixes
Font rendering issues can significantly impact the user experience in grocery list apps, leading to frustration and potential revenue loss. To address this problem, it's essential to understand the te
Introduction to Font Rendering Issues in Grocery List Apps
Font rendering issues can significantly impact the user experience in grocery list apps, leading to frustration and potential revenue loss. To address this problem, it's essential to understand the technical root causes, real-world impact, and specific examples of font rendering issues in grocery list apps.
Technical Root Causes of Font Rendering Issues
Font rendering issues in grocery list apps can be caused by several technical factors, including:
- Inconsistent font sizes and styles: Using different font sizes and styles throughout the app can lead to inconsistent rendering, particularly on various devices and screen resolutions.
- Insufficient font loading: Failing to load fonts properly or using incorrect font formats can result in rendering issues, such as font replacement or incomplete text display.
- Device and platform limitations: Different devices and platforms have unique font rendering capabilities, which can cause issues if not accounted for in the app's design and development.
- Dynamic content and scrolling: Grocery list apps often involve dynamic content and scrolling, which can lead to font rendering issues if not optimized for performance.
Real-World Impact of Font Rendering Issues
Font rendering issues can have a significant impact on user experience and app success. Some of the real-world consequences include:
- User complaints and negative reviews: Users may leave negative reviews and complain about font rendering issues, affecting the app's store rating and reputation.
- Revenue loss: A poor user experience can lead to decreased user engagement, reduced sales, and ultimately, revenue loss.
- Competitive disadvantage: Grocery list apps with font rendering issues may be at a competitive disadvantage compared to apps with smooth and consistent font rendering.
Examples of Font Rendering Issues in Grocery List Apps
Here are 7 specific examples of font rendering issues that can occur in grocery list apps:
- Inconsistent font sizes in list items: Font sizes may vary between list items, making it difficult for users to read and navigate the app.
- Cut-off text in search results: Search results may display cut-off text due to insufficient font loading or incorrect font sizes.
- Blurred or pixelated fonts on product details pages: Fonts may appear blurred or pixelated on product details pages, particularly on lower-resolution devices.
- Missing fonts in special offers sections: Special offers sections may display missing fonts or font replacement, making it difficult for users to read and understand promotions.
- Font rendering issues on checkout pages: Checkout pages may experience font rendering issues, such as inconsistent font sizes or styles, which can lead to user frustration and cart abandonment.
- Incorrect font rendering on login and registration pages: Login and registration pages may display incorrect font rendering, making it challenging for users to enter their credentials or complete the registration process.
- Dynamic font sizing issues in recipe sections: Recipe sections may experience dynamic font sizing issues, causing text to overlap or become unreadable.
Detecting Font Rendering Issues
To detect font rendering issues in grocery list apps, developers can use various tools and techniques, including:
- Visual inspection: Manually reviewing the app on different devices and platforms to identify font rendering issues.
- Automated testing: Using automated testing tools, such as SUSA, to detect font rendering issues and other UI-related problems.
- User feedback and testing: Collecting user feedback and conducting user testing to identify font rendering issues and other usability problems.
Fixing Font Rendering Issues
To fix font rendering issues in grocery list apps, developers can follow these code-level guidelines:
- Use consistent font sizes and styles: Ensure that font sizes and styles are consistent throughout the app to prevent rendering issues.
- Optimize font loading: Use techniques like font caching and preloading to ensure that fonts are loaded properly and efficiently.
- Use device and platform-specific font rendering: Use device and platform-specific font rendering capabilities to ensure that fonts are rendered correctly on different devices and platforms.
- Optimize dynamic content and scrolling: Optimize dynamic content and scrolling to prevent font rendering issues and ensure smooth performance.
Prevention: Catching Font Rendering Issues Before Release
To prevent font rendering issues in grocery list apps, developers can follow these best practices:
- Conduct regular visual inspections: Regularly review the app on different devices and platforms to identify font rendering issues early in the development process.
- Use automated testing tools: Use automated testing tools, such as SUSA, to detect font rendering issues and other UI-related problems.
- Collect user feedback and conduct user testing: Collect user feedback and conduct user testing to identify font rendering issues and other usability problems.
- Follow platform-specific guidelines: Follow platform-specific guidelines for font rendering and UI design to ensure that the app is optimized for different devices and platforms.
By following these guidelines and using the right tools and techniques, developers can prevent font rendering issues in grocery list apps and ensure a smooth and consistent user experience. SUSA, an autonomous QA platform, can help developers detect font rendering issues and other UI-related problems, allowing them to fix these issues before release and improve the overall quality of their app. With SUSA, developers can upload their APK or web URL and explore their app autonomously, without the need for scripts. SUSA also provides features like WCAG 2.1 AA accessibility testing, security testing, and CI/CD integration, making it a comprehensive solution for ensuring the quality and usability of grocery list apps.
Test Your App Autonomously
Upload your APK or URL. SUSA explores like 10 real users — finds bugs, accessibility violations, and security issues. No scripts.
Try SUSA Free